1961 Lancia Appia vs. 1992 Mazda Eunos

To start off, 1992 Mazda Eunos is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1961 Lancia Appia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1961 Lancia Appia would be higher. At 1,995 cc (6 cylinders), 1992 Mazda Eunos is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Mazda Eunos (138 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 79 more horse power than 1961 Lancia Appia. (59 HP @ 5400 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1992 Mazda Eunos should accelerate faster than 1961 Lancia Appia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1992 Mazda Eunos weights approximately 441 kg more than 1961 Lancia Appia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1961 Lancia Appia is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1961 Lancia Appia.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1992 Mazda Eunos,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1992 Mazda Eunos (167 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 82 more torque (in Nm) than 1961 Lancia Appia. (85 Nm @ 4250 RPM). This means 1992 Mazda Eunos will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1961 Lancia Appia.

Compare all specifications:

1961 Lancia Appia 1992 Mazda Eunos
Make Lancia Mazda
Model Appia Eunos
Year Released 1961 1992
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1090 cc 1995 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Horse Power 59 HP 138 HP
Engine RPM 5400 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 85 Nm 167 Nm
Torque RPM 4250 RPM 3000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 68 mm 78 mm
Engine Stroke Size 75 mm 69.6 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 8.0:1 9.5:1
Top Speed 145 km/hour 198 km/hour
Drive Type Rear Front
Number of Seats 4 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 789 kg 1230 kg
Vehicle Length 3990 mm 4550 mm
Vehicle Width 1440 mm 1710 mm
Wheelbase Size 2520 mm 2620 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 42 L 60 L
